I have a cheap EBay one, wish i had gone for a carbtune..
The needles are not damped very well so flick up and down like nobodies business.
only way i could do it was hold the revs at a steady 3000 rpm and then let go and adjust. it now idles better than it did before and runs better so it looks to have worked.
long story short.. get a carbtune.....
